Abstract

Un inserto boquilla de lanza para una lanza de material refractario para hacer avanzar un alambre de material aditivo hacia el interior de una cantidad de metal fundido por debajo de la superficie del metal fundido, está hecho de un material quecomprende oxido de circonio estabilizado y grafito, con lo que se incrementa de manera sustancial la resistencia del inserto boquilla de lanza contra la corrosion. Reivindicacion 10: Una lanza para hacer avanzar un alambre de material aditivohacia el interior de una cantidad de metal fundido por debajo de la superficie del metal fundido, caracterizada porque comprende: una envuelta de material refractario, que tiene una salida; un conducto, situado dentro de la envuelta de materialrefractario que provee un pasadizo para transportar el alambre hacia la salida; y un inserto boquilla de lanza, provisto dentro de la envuelta de material refractario, en comunicacion con el conducto y que forma la salida, en la que el insertoboquilla de lanza está hecho de un material que comprende oxido de circonio estabilizado y grafito.
